Output 1986fa12914dc79be1289115822a3b8c81db52035b7cd09cf3f20ac518de0d1e:16

value
452552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9aaa641624fdf2c65ae92dd0d02056240a44789 OP_EQUAL
address
3HA8YtniakGgKFsqLvie2syrmawL9UCRc2
transaction
1986fa12914dc79be1289115822a3b8c81db52035b7cd09cf3f20ac518de0d1e
confirmations
271042
spent
true